Abstract

    With more and more importance of innovation in the development and management of organizations, more attentions are given to All-Involvement Innovation (AII) of a firm. However, the human side was always viewed as “a dependent variable” of innovation and the environment as “a independent variable” in the most relevant studies. And few attentions are paid to the functional mechanism of AII, which leads to the AII failure in companies. Therefore, a conceptual model including five factors, which are Innovative Environment (IE), Individual Innovation (II), Collective Innovation (CI), AII, and Innovative Performance (IP), were set up. Further questionnaire survey was done; data are collected and analyzed statistically using the Structural Equation Model (SEM) for testing the theoretical hypotheses. The conclusion were drawn that AII cannot be simply seen as the outcomes of the IE. It is the result of the interactions of II, CI, and IE. AII decided on not only IP but also IE. At the same time, the outcomes from the positive study also test such perspectives that IE influences IP indirectly by motivating II and CI. This result was different with the general view of “IE decides directly on IP”.
